L326 JOH is a 1994 Ford Orion in Blue with a 1,796c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 1994 Ford Orion models, the average MOT pass rate is 61.2% with a typical mileage of 64,058 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Ford Orion f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 15,192 recorded failures. If you're considering buying L326 JOH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Orion typically stays on UK roads for around 41 years. At 32 years old, this Ford Orion is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
